Why Renting Equipment Is So Popular in Orlando

Orlando is very different from many other tourist destinations. The city covers a large area, the climate is hot and humid most of the year, and visitors often spend long days outdoors at theme parks. A significant percentage of travelers come with children, which dramatically increases the amount of gear required.

As a result, vacation gear rental in Orlando has become the norm. Instead of purchasing items for short-term use or dealing with oversized luggage, travelers prefer to rent what they need and have it delivered directly to their accommodation.

What You Should Bring With You to Orlando

Some items are personal or essential enough that it makes sense to bring them from home.

Basic checklist:

  • travel documents and insurance
  • sunscreen and sun protection products
  • lightweight summer clothing
  • comfortable walking shoes for theme parks
  • personal electronics and chargers

These essentials cover day-to-day needs and don’t justify renting or repurchasing.

Traveling to Orlando With Kids: Important Considerations

Orlando is one of the most family-friendly cities in the United States, but comfort largely depends on preparation. Renting baby and child equipment allows parents to focus on enjoying the trip rather than managing logistics.

Commonly rented items for families include strollers with sun protection, car seats, cribs, and feeding chairs. These rentals make long days at theme parks far more manageable.

Renting Gear for Homes, Villas, and Outdoor Relaxation

Many vacation rentals in Orlando feature backyards, patios, pools, and BBQ areas. Renting additional equipment can significantly enhance the experience.

Popular rental items for home stays:

  • gas or charcoal grills
  • propane tanks
  • outdoor furniture
  • portable coolers

Renting these items allows guests to fully enjoy their rental property without investing in equipment they’ll only use briefly.
